技术文摘
Oracle表空间管理与用户管理简要介绍
Oracle表空间管理与用户管理简要介绍
在Oracle数据库管理中,表空间管理与用户管理是至关重要的环节,它们对于数据库的高效运行和数据安全起着关键作用。
表空间是Oracle数据库用于逻辑存储的结构,它将物理数据文件组合在一起,为数据库对象(如表、索引等)提供存储区域。合理的表空间管理能够优化数据存储,提高数据库性能。表空间的创建需要综合考虑业务需求。例如,将不同业务模块的数据分别存储在不同的表空间中,这样便于管理和维护,同时在数据备份和恢复时也能更灵活地操作。表空间的大小规划也不容忽视。过小的表空间可能导致存储空间不足,影响业务正常运行;而过大则会造成资源浪费。管理员需要根据历史数据增长趋势和未来业务发展预估,合理分配表空间大小。定期对表空间进行监控和管理也必不可少,如查看表空间的使用情况、是否存在碎片等,以便及时进行调整和优化。
用户管理则涉及到数据库的访问权限控制和安全管理。在Oracle中,用户是连接到数据库并执行操作的主体。创建用户时,要为其指定用户名、密码以及默认表空间等信息。根据用户的工作职责和安全级别,为其授予相应的系统权限和对象权限。系统权限决定了用户可以执行的数据库级别的操作,如创建表、删除用户等;对象权限则控制用户对特定数据库对象(如表、视图等)的操作权限,如查询、插入、更新和删除等。通过严格的权限管理,可以确保只有授权用户能够访问和操作相应的数据,从而保障数据的安全性和完整性。
Oracle的表空间管理和用户管理相互配合,共同构建了一个稳定、安全且高效的数据库环境,为企业的信息化建设提供坚实的基础。
TAGS: 数据库管理 Oracle数据库 Oracle用户管理 Oracle表空间管理
- Tailwind CSS 真的好吗?六大讨厌理由
- Spring Cloud 远程调用 OpenFeign :颠覆认知的知识点
- NET 序列化工具:SharpSerializer 库的快速入门与轻松序列化操作
- Java 设计规范及代码风格:确保代码的一致性和可读性
- 基于 Docker 与 Kubernetes 的容器化智能家居系统实现
- 携程门票活动商品结构的效率与用户体验提升之路
- 八个助程序员接私活盈利的开源项目
- OC 消息发送与转发机制的原理
- 此技术让浏览器支持运行 Node.js、Rust、Python、PHP、C++、Java 代码
- Java 并行 GC 的运用与优化
- Java 中枚举的神奇力量探秘
- 10 个提升 VS Code 工作效率的技巧
- 全球科技业两年裁 40 万 而 LLM 博士获 620 万年薪 offer
- 探索 eBPF 可观测性:其如何革新观测方式
- IntelliJ IDEA 中 JUnit 和 Mockito 单元测试超简单